    34 Minute Freeze
    I've been searching all over the web for a solution to this.

    I'm installing Windows XP Pro on a computer that is currently running Vista. I know Vista is better, but I need XP Pro to log into the server. The installation gets to the 34 minute countdown and freezes up.

    I've tried unplugging everything but the keyboard and monitor. I've tried deleting usbport.inf, which was showing as an error in setupapi.log, does anyone have any other suggestions?

    OK what exactly have you tried?

    In cases like this I would make sure that you use the most basic of perif's i.e. keyboard/mouse, so time to dig out the old ps2 ones.
    Also make sure you follow the FULL format route to ensure everything has been wiped.
    Have you tried different install media ?
    Can't think of anythig else, please let us know what you have tried.

    I think I figured out the problem. From what I've been reading, HP systems designed to run on Windows Vista (Which this system is) has hardware that XP can't assign drivers to (Thus why it keeps locking up in at the driver installation point.

    I've got a consultant coming by who is going to piece together drivers from older HP machines. Thanks for the advice, though. :D
